Professional Background

Alix Dumoulin is a dynamic and passionate individual currently advancing her expertise in applied data science as an MSc student at The London School of Economics and Political Science (LSE). With an impressive academic history and a commitment to digital innovation and public policy, Alix is making significant strides in the realm of data ethics and management. As the co-founder and Chief Data Scientist of Ethi, she is dedicated to creating the first platform designed to help individuals reclaim, control, and benefit from their personal data, empowering users in the ever-evolving digital landscape.

Prior to her current pursuits, Alix garnered valuable experience through various internships and leadership roles, including a Business Development Summer Internship at Liquidnet and a Strategy Consulting Summer Internship at Deloitte. She also served as an Insight Programme Intern at The Boston Consulting Group (BCG), where she gained insights into strategic consulting methodologies as well as practical experience in data analysis and problem-solving.

Alongside her technical skills, Alix has showcased her leadership abilities in several prominent organizations. She co-founded Talos and served as its Vice President, further demonstrating her commitment to building community and fostering innovation. Additionally, she was the President of the UCL Diplomacy in Action Society, where she aimed to enhance students' understanding of international relations and diplomacy through practical engagement. Her role at the UCL Consulting Society as an External Relations Executive allowed her to bridge connections and expand the outreach of the society.

Education and Achievements

Alix's educational background is characterized by her academic excellence and diverse experiential learning opportunities. She earned a Master of Science in Applied Social Data Science from LSE with distinction, reflecting her strong grasp of the complex interplay between data and society. Her foundational knowledge in this field stems from her Bachelor of Science degree in Philosophy, Politics & Economics (PPE) with Data Science from University College London (UCL), where she graduated with First Class Honours.

Her academic journey also includes enriching international experiences through summer programs, where she studied Public Policy at the Diplomatic Academy of Vienna and Computer Simulation and Interactive Media at Stanford University. These opportunities have equipped Alix with a global perspective and innovative thinking critical for addressing contemporary challenges in policy and technology. Her early education culminated with a Baccalaureat from Lycée la Rochefoucauld.
